Description
FIG. 1 is a perspective view of a tire tread and buttress showing our new design it being understood that the pattern is repeated uniformly throughout the circumference of the tread and buttress and the opposite side is the same as the side shown;
FIG. 2 is a front elevation view thereof; and,
FIG. 3 is a fragmentary side elevational view thereof.
The broken line showing of environmental structure in FIGS. 1 and 3 of the drawing is for illustrative purposes only and forms no part of the claimed design.
